Authors | Year | Causative Fungus | Diagnosis | Antifungal Treatment |
---|---|---|---|---|
Burke and Zych [5] | 2002 | Phycomycoses | Histopathology | Amphotericin B |
Muscolo et al. [6] | 2009 | (1). Rhizopus microsporus (2). Rhizopus microsporus (3). Rhizopus microsporus (4). Rhizopus microsporus (5). Rhizopus microsporus (6). Candida albicans | Cultures and histopathology | Amphotericin B |
Antkowiak et al. [7] | 2011 | Aspergillus flavus | Cultures and histopathology | Voriconazole and caspofungin |
Sun et al. [8] | 2012 | Aspergillus spp. | Histopathology | NR |
Mirzatolooei [9] | 2014 | Alternaria spp. | Cultures | NR |
Castro et al. [3] | 2016 | Candida glabrata | Cultures | Caspofungin, micafungin, voriconazole |
Gamarra et al. [2] | 2018 | (1). Rhizopus microsporus (2). Rhizopus microsporus (3). Rhizopus microsporus | Histopathology, PCR | Amphotericin B |
